Actin-binding proteins are effectors of cell signalling and coordinators of cellular behaviour. Research on the Dictyostelium actin cytoskeleton has focused both on the elucidation of the function of bona fide actin-binding proteins as well as on proteins involved in signalling to the cytoskeleton. A major part of this work is concerned with the analysis of Dictyostelium mutants. The results derived from these investigations have added to our understanding of the role of the actin cytoskeleton in growth and development. Furthermore, the studies have identified several cellular and developmental stages that are particularly sensitive to an unbalanced cytoskeleton. In addition, use of GFP fusion proteins is revealing the spatial and temporal dynamics of interactions between actin-associated proteins and the cytoskeleton.
